APEX Framework: Member List

NVIDIA APEX

nvidia::apex::ExplicitHierarchicalMesh Member List
This is the complete list of members for nvidia::apex::ExplicitHierarchicalMesh, including all inherited members.
addMaterialFrame()=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
addSubmesh(const ExplicitSubmeshData &submeshData)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
buildCollisionGeometryForPart(uint32_t partIndex, const CollisionVolumeDesc &desc)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
buildCollisionGeometryForRootChunkParts(const CollisionDesc &desc, bool aggregateRootChunkParentCollision=true)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
calculateMeshBSP(uint32_t randomSeed, IProgressListener *progressListener=NULL, const uint32_t *microgridSize=NULL, BSPOpenMode::Enum meshMode=BSPOpenMode::Automatic)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
chunkBounds(uint32_t chunkIndex)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
chunkCount() const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
chunkFlags(uint32_t chunkIndex)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
chunkUniqueID(uint32_t chunkI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
clear(bool keepRoot=false)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
convexHullCount(uint32_t partIndex)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
convexHulls(uint32_t partIndex)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
deserialize(PxFileBuf &stream, Embedding &embedding)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
displacementMapVolume() const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
Enum enum namenvidia::apex::ExplicitHierarchicalMesh
ExplicitHierarchicalMesh()nvidia::apex::ExplicitHierarchicalMesh [inline, protected]
getMaterialFrame(uint32_t index)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
getMaterialFrameCount() const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
instancedPositionOffset(uint32_t chunkI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
instancedUVOffset(uint32_t chunkI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
maxDepth() const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
meshBounds(uint32_t partIndex)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
meshTriangleCount(uint32_t partIndex)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
meshTriangles(uint32_t partI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
parentIndex(uint32_t chunkI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
partCount() const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
partIndex(uint32_t chunkI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
reduceHulls(const CollisionDesc &desc, bool inflated)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
release()=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
replaceInteriorSubmeshes(uint32_t partIndex, uint32_t frameCount, uint32_t *frameIndices, uint32_t submeshI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
serialize(PxFileBuf &stream, Embedding &embedding)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
set(const ExplicitHierarchicalMesh &mesh)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
setMaterialFrame(uint32_t index, const nvidia::MaterialFrame &materialFrame)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
submeshCount() const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
submeshData(uint32_t submeshI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
surfaceNormal(uint32_t partIndex)=0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
visualize(RenderDebugInterface &debugRender, uint32_t flags, uint32_t index=0) const =0nvidia::apex::ExplicitHierarchicalMesh [pure virtual]
VisualizeMeshBSPAllRegions enum value (defined in nvidia::apex::ExplicitHierarchicalMesh)nvidia::apex::ExplicitHierarchicalMesh
VisualizeMeshBSPInsideRegions enum valuenvidia::apex::ExplicitHierarchicalMesh
VisualizeMeshBSPOutsideRegions enum valuenvidia::apex::ExplicitHierarchicalMesh
VisualizeMeshBSPSingleRegion enum valuenvidia::apex::ExplicitHierarchicalMesh
VisualizeSliceBSPInsideRegions enum valuenvidia::apex::ExplicitHierarchicalMesh
VisualizeSliceBSPOutsideRegions enum valuenvidia::apex::ExplicitHierarchicalMesh
VisualizeSliceBSPSingleRegion enum valuenvidia::apex::ExplicitHierarchicalMesh
~ExplicitHierarchicalMesh() (defined in nvidia::apex::ExplicitHierarchicalMesh)nvidia::apex::ExplicitHierarchicalMesh [inline, protected, virtual]

Generated on Fri Dec 15 2017 13:58:38
Copyright © 2012-2017 NVIDIA Corporation, 2701 San Tomas Expressway, Santa Clara, CA 95050 U.S.A. All rights reserved.